Term microtubule organizing center attachment site ID (Ontology) GO:0034992 (Gene Ontology)
Definition A region of the nuclear envelope to which a microtubule organizing center (MTOC) attaches; protein complexes embedded in the nuclear envelope mediate direct or indirect linkages between the microtubule cytoskeleton and the nuclear envelope.[ PubMed:18692466 ]
Also Known As "MAS" ; "microtubule organising centre attachment site" ; "MTOC attachment site"
